  • 🧄 Move Over Cheese Curds… Deep-Fried Cheese Whips Are the New Snack Sensation!

    deep fried Ron's mozzarella cheese whips

    You’ve had deep-fried cheese curds… but have you tried deep-fried cheese whips? These crispy, golden bites wrap Ron’s Mozzarella Whips in a savory batter loaded with garlic, herbs, and a hint of heat. The result? A cheesy, crunchy, utterly addictive upgrade to your favorite fair food.

    Whether you’re serving them as a shareable appetizer, a bold game-day snack, or just leveling up your cheese game, this recipe delivers major flavor with serious farm-fresh melt.

    🧀 Ingredients

    • 2 cups all-purpose flour
    • 1 tablespoon cornstarch (adds crispiness)
    • 1½ teaspoons baking powder
    •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
    • ½ teaspoon onion powder
    •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
    • ½ teaspoon salt
    •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
    • 2 eggs
    • 1½ cups milk
    •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ard (for extra tang)
    • 1 (16 oz) pack Ron’s Mozzarella Whips, cut into 2″ pieces
    • Vegetable oil, for frying
    • Fresh parsley, for garnish
    • Optional dip: marinara, ranch, or hot honey

    👨‍🍳 Instructions

    1. In a large bowl, combine the flour, cornstarch, baking powder,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
    2. In another b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, and Dijon mustard.
    3.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ry and stir until smooth.
    4. Gently fold in pieces of Ron’s Mozzarella Whips until coated.
    5. Heat 2–3 inches of oil to 375°F in a heavy skillet or deep fryer.
    6. Drop batter-coated cheese pieces into the oil in small clusters.
    7. Fry 2–3 minutes per side until golden brown and crisp.
    8. Drain on paper towels and sprinkle with chopped parsley.
    9. Serve hot with your favorite savory dipping sauce.

    🌿 Why It Works

    The garlic and paprika in the batter enhance the creamy mozzarella, creating a snack that’s rich, crispy, and seriously addictive. This version makes a great appetizer, game day snack, or shareable plate.

  • Funnel Cake Gets a Cheesy Twist with Ron’s Mozzarella Whips

    Nothing says summer like the sweet smell of funnel cakes wafting through a county fair. But what if we told you there’s a way to make them even better? Introducing: Funnel Cake with Ron’s Mozzarella Whips — a crispy, golden treat with a cheesy, melty center that’s sure to surprise and delight.

    At Ron’s Wisconsin Cheese, we’re always dreaming up new ways to bring our farm-fresh products into your kitchen. This recipe takes classic funnel cake batter and wraps it around bite-sized pieces of our signature Mozzarella Cheese Whips, resulting in an irresistible sweet-and-savory snack that’s perfect for fairs, parties, or a fun family weekend.


    🧀 Why Ron’s Mozzarella Whips?

    Our Mozzarella Whips are handcrafted with milk from our own cows, giving them that farm-fresh flavor and signature squeak. Their creamy texture melts beautifully when fried, turning every bite of this funnel cake into a warm, gooey delight.


    📋 Ingredients

    • 2 cups all-purpose flour
    • 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
    • 1 teaspoon baking powder
    • ½ teaspoon salt
    • 2 eggs
    • 1½ cups milk
    •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
    • 1 (9 oz) pack Ron’s Mozzarella Cheese Whips, cut into 2″ pieces
    • Vegetable oil for frying
    • Powdered sugar for dusting
    • Sliced fresh strawberries (optional)

    👩‍🍳 Instructions

    1. In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
    2. In a separate bowl, beat the eggs, milk, and vanilla. Slowly combine with the dry ingredients to form a smooth batter.
    3. Gently fold in the mozzarella whip pieces.
    4. Heat 2–3 inches of oil in a deep skillet or fryer to 375°F (190°C).
    5. Using a spoon or squeeze bottle, drizzle the batter into the hot oil in a zigzag motion, forming small funnel cakes.
    6. Fry each side for 2–3 minutes until golden brown, then remove and drain on paper towels.
    7. Dust with powdered sugar and top with sliced strawberries if desired.

    🎉 Serving Tips

    Serve warm with a side of strawberry jam or a drizzle of honey. These are a hit at summer BBQs, late-night snacks, or even weekend brunch.

  • 🧀 3 Easy Cheese Board Ideas with Ron’s Curds and Spreads

    🧀 3 Easy Cheese Board Ideas with Ron’s Curds and Spreads

    Cheese boards are a must for summer parties, family nights, or just treating yourself after a long day. The best part? You don’t need to be a chef — just start with farm-fresh cheese and a few crowd-pleasing extras.

    Here are 3 simple, delicious cheese board ideas using Ron’s curds, spreads, and blocks that anyone can assemble in 10 minutes or less.


    🧺 1. The Classic Midwest Snack Board

    Perfect for: Tailgates, lake days, backyard BBQs

    What to include:

    • Ron’s Cheddar Cheese Curds (Original or Jalapeño)
    • Pretzel sticks or beer bread cubes
    • Summer sausage or brat slices
    • Pickles & mustard
    • Baby carrots & ranch dip

    Tip: Keep it casual. Serve on a cutting board or cookie sheet — squeaky curds speak for themselves.


    🍎 2. The Sweet & Savory Board

    Perfect for: Brunches, book clubs, or date night

    What to include:

    • Ron’s Snow Cheddar Block (cubed or sliced)
    • Apple slices, grapes, or dried cranberries
    • Honey or fig jam
    • Almonds or candied pecans
    • Crackers or sourdough rounds

    Tip: Use small jars or ramekins for the spreads and nuts — adds a polished touch with zero extra effort.


    🧄 3. The Bold & Flavorful Board

    Perfect for: Evening guests or serious cheese lovers

    What to include:

    • Ron’s Garlic & Dill Cheese Curds
    • Ron’s Herbs & Spice Cheese Spread
    • Pickled veggies (onions, beans, peppers)
    • Salami or prosciutto
    • Multigrain or seeded crackers

    Tip: Spread the cheese on crackers and pre-top with garnish — makes it easy for guests to grab and go.


    Make It Yours

    Mix and match based on your favorite Ron’s products — all you need is something creamy, something crunchy, and something unexpected.

    2. The Squeak Is Real (And It Matters)

    That signature squeak? It means your curds are ultra-fresh. The squeak happens when the protein structure in the cheese is still intact and bounces against your teeth. The fresher the curd, the louder the squeak. If you know, you know.
